A watering device for agricultural planting according to claim 1, wherein the adjusting assembly (7) comprises an electric telescopic rod (71) which is installed on the top end of the water tank (4) and the telescopic end of the electric telescopic rod is vertically upward, the telescopic end of the electric telescopic rod (71) is connected with a cross (72) which is located above the spray head (5), four ends of the cross (72) are hinged with the corresponding spray head (5) through connecting rods, U-shaped frames (73) which are located in the same horizontal direction with the spray head (5) are installed on four sides of the electric telescopic rod (71), and the opening of each U-shaped frame (73) is hinged with the corresponding spray head (5) through a rotating shaft.
3. A watering device for agricultural planting according to claim 1, wherein a collection assembly (8) for collecting rainwater is provided on the water tank (4), the collection assembly (8) comprises a hollow pipe (81) in vertical direction communicating with the water tank (4), the top end of the hollow pipe (81) is communicated with a funnel (82), a filter screen is connected in the funnel (82), and a sealing plug is installed on the water inlet (3).
4. A watering device for agricultural planting according to claim 3, characterised in that a non-return valve (21) is arranged between the water pipe (2) and the water inlet (3) and is adapted to only allow water to enter but not to allow water to exit.
